6 charisma gives you -2 to diplomacy checks. People who are Unfriendly will turn Hostile if you get less than 5 on a check, but for all higher ones you just need a 1 to get them to stay at that level. So get some way to get +2 to diplomacy checks - five ranks in Knowledge(nobility), for instance. Then you're set.

Get +3 more to diplomacy and you won't need to worry about turning people Hostile anymore. That's a 900gp custom item, or a 50gp masterwork tool and a 100gp +1 competence item.

If someone is Unfriendly, a Diplomacy roll of less than 5 will make that Unfriendly creature Hostile (assuming that your GM uses the Diplomacy rules, that is.)

You'll need to roll 21 or higher to get someone Hostile to become Unfriendly, however.

So if you spend five skill points in Knowledge(Nobility) (or Bluff or Sense Motive) you get a +2 synergy bonus. In retrospect its actually cheaper to just spend four skill points buying Diplomacy cross-class.

I guess there's also some actual magic items that give good boosts as well, but I don't think there are any published ones below 1,000gp.

So 50gp for a masterwork item of Diplomacy (make-up? Perfume? Diplomacy for Dummies?) is probably the best method.
